1. What are cookies?
Cookies are small text files placed on your device when you visit a website. They help the site remember you, understand how you use it, and (in some cases) deliver personalized content or ads. Similar technologies include local storage, pixels, SDKs, and device identifiers.

U.S. state privacy rights
Residents of California, Colorado, Connecticut, Virginia, Utah, and other states with comprehensive privacy laws have the right to opt out of the “sale” or “sharing” of personal information for cross-context behavioral advertising. Our use of Google AdSense may constitute “sharing” under these laws. To opt out, submit a request via our contact page with the subject line “Do Not Sell or Share.”
